Pre-Operative Assessments
Prior to your cataract surgery, you'll need to undergo pre-operative evaluations to make sure that you're gotten ready for the procedure. These evaluations play an important function in figuring out the total wellness of your eyes and identifying any kind of prospective dangers or difficulties.
The assessments normally consist of an extensive eye evaluation, which involves measuring your visual acuity, checking your eye pressure, and analyzing the health and wellness of your retina and cornea. In addition, your physician may order additional examinations such as biometry, which measures the length and form of your eye, and optical coherence tomography (OCT), which provides comprehensive pictures of your eye frameworks.
These evaluations aid your cosmetic surgeon develop a customized medical plan and make sure that you obtain the very best possible end result from your cataract surgical treatment.
Day of the Procedure
On the day of your cataract surgery, you'll be given with certain instructions to follow. These directions are important to make sure that the treatment goes smoothly which you're well-prepared.
One of one of the most important instructions is to stay clear of eating or alcohol consumption anything for a few hours before the surgery. This is because anesthetic will be used throughout the treatment and a vacant tummy is essential to avoid any kind of complications.
